Based on an analysis of galvanic corrosion research the research reported herein was formulated to examine the measurement of polarisation curves for Mg to develop a methodology whereby reliable polarisation curves can be measured for Mg Cathodic polarisation curves were measured for high purity Mg in 3 5% NaCl saturated with Mg(OH)(2) using three specimen types (i) mounted specimens (ii) specimens hung by fishing line and (m) plug-in specimens Cathodic polarisation curves were evaluated to yield the corrosion current density t(corr) and the corresponding corrosion rate P(i) which was compared with the corrosion rate evaluated from hydrogen evolution measurements P(H) and the corrosion rate evaluated by weight loss measurements P(w) Mounted specimens produced values of corrosion rate P(i) three times larger than values of corrosion rate P(i) for plug-in specimens attributed to crevice corrosion in the mounted specimens Crevice corrosion in Mg is totally unexpected from prior research The plug-in specimen configuration was designed to have no crevice and to allow simultaneous measurement of P(H) and P(i) P(i) was consistently less than P(H) and indicated an apparent valence
